And as we have actually said, don't simply go with small plants; tiny urban gardens can take care of large plants and trees and selecting these over tiny picky shrubs will make the area really feel larger and much more interesting


Make use of large containers they don't completely dry out as rapidly as smaller sized pots, so they are less work to keep water. Select hardscaping components for an urban garden The organized lines, unbalanced setup, and use of contrasting materials in this London-based Victorian balcony's yard layout develop a seamless connection with the style, making it show up as an all-natural expansion of the total aesthetic.


Plant vertically Cover the walls in greenery, whether that be lovely climbers that ripple messily over your fencing or something more included and contemporary like a living wall. Take advantage of a light well garden Whitewashed walls and pale floor tiles turn it from a dark and dull area into an area you 'd want to spend time on a Sunday early morning with a cup of coffee.

Community yards are semi-public rooms shared by an area of next-door neighbors and various other people where they jointly participate in growing fruits, veggies, or flowers, sharing labor and harvest. It's excellent to get associated with these lasting projects as they're similarly advantageous for you, the neighborhood, and the setting. Community yards are located in neighborhoods, however can additionally be developed in institutions, household lands, or institutions, such as healthcare facilities.


City Blooming for Dummies




Some of the environmental benefits of area yards consist of: Reconstruction of uninhabited land and ecosystems by repurposing themProduction and updating of water seepage and various other ecological community servicesPromotion of biodiversity by growing indigenous plantsEducating the neighborhood regarding gardening, city agriculture, and their benefitsReduction of food transportation minimizing air pollutionPromotion of lasting farming practicesFostering social inclusionThe over ecological benefits reveal the overall significance of area gardens and their contribution to supplying environment for organisms and food to the locals, eliminating food insecurity.


Area yards contribute to accomplishing these goals as they are easily accessible to all despite class, age, sex, education and learning, profession, etc, and play a significant function in increasing awareness and knowledge concerning gardening and urban agriculture among the people. Neighborhood gardens highlight a demand for city residents to return to nature.
